LANE v. DEROCHER


360 A.2d 141 (1976)

Dorothy E. LANE et al. v. Alix DEROCHER and Paul J. Derocher et al.

Supreme Judicial Court of Maine.

July 14, 1976.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Law Offices of James G. Palmer by H. Denton Bumgardner, James G. Palmer, Brunswick, for plaintiffs.

Marshall, Raymond & Beliveau by John V. Bonneau, John G. Marshall, Lewiston, for Alix Derocher.

Murray, Plumb & Murray by Peter L. Murray, Myer M. Marcus, Portland, for Paul Derocher.

Before DUFRESNE, C. J., and POMEROY, WERNICK and ARCHIBALD, JJ.


WERNICK, Justice.

Plaintiffs, Dorothy E. Lane, Samuel Holbrook, Walter C. Hinds, Mary A. Hinds, Sumner Holbrook and Donald Watson, and defendants, Alix Derocher and Paul J. Derocher, are owners of lots of land in Blackstone Park, so-called, on Mere Point in the Town of Brunswick, Maine.
